Generation Plants
Power generation is the process by which a primary source - such as the sun, wind, water, fossil fuels or hydrogen - is transformed into usable electricity for human, industrial or urban consumption. This process is fundamental to the development of modern society, as it powers homes, factories, infrastructure and transport systems. There are multiple generation technologies, both renewable and conventional, each with its advantages, limitations and environmental impacts. The current challenge is to ensure sufficient, sustainable and clean energy production to meet growing demand without compromising the planet's balance.

Offshore Wind Farms
IPROCEL has participated in some of the major offshore wind energy developments in Europe and America, which has consolidated its position as a strategic supplier in the offshore wind sector. The company has provided supervision and commissioning services for wind turbines (WTG) and electrical evacuation systems, both in offshore and onshore substations, in projects such as Baltic Eagle (477 MW, Germany, 2021), Saint Brieuc (496 MW, France, 2021) and Vineyard Wind (800 MW, USA, 2022).
This experience allows us to add value in highly demanding environments, meeting the highest standards of quality, safety and technical efficiency.

Solar Thermal Plants
IPROCEL has participated in the assembly and commissioning of nearly 2 GW of installed capacity in solar thermal plants located in some of the main countries in the development of this technology, such as Spain, South Africa, Morocco and Israel. Our experience covers both tower plants and installations with parabolic trough collectors, which allows us to adapt to different designs and technological configurations.

Conventional Generation
Since 1993, when we executed the commissioning of the Barranco de Tirajana diesel power plant in Gran Canaria, IPROCEL has participated in the implementation of approximately 39 GW of installed capacity in thermal power plants. We have been involved in all the thermal power plants in the Canary Islands, consolidating our experience in island and isolated environments.
Our first international experience was in Jamaica, and since then we have expanded our activity to more than 40 countries in 4 continents.
